Get Lost In The Moments, Not The Route. The Rv 1090 Gps Navigator Features A Large 10 Edge-To-Edge Display You Can View In Portrait Or Landscape Mode. It Creates Custom Routes That Take Into Account The Size And Weight Of Your Rv (Not Available In All Areas. Entering Your Rv Or Trailer Profile Characteristics Does Not Guarantee Your Rvs Characteristics Will Be Accounted For In All Route Suggestions. Always Defer To All Posted Road Signs And Road Conditions) And Provides Road Warnings For Steep Grades, Sharp Curves And More.
